A ceiling fan with 60 centimeter diameter blades is turning at 65 rpm. Assume the fan coasts to a stop 22 seconds after being turned off.

a) Obtain the speed of the tip of the blade 14 seconds after the fan is turned off?

b) Find through how many revolutions does the fan turn while stopping?
